  • 시화호 내 형성된 위성류 자연 군락의 개체군 특성을 밝히기 위해 매목의 크기, 공간분포 및 뿌리의 생장형태를 국내 최초로 조사하였다. 위성류 군락은 남북으로 약 350 m, 동서로 270 m 범위에 형성되어 있었다. 동일한 뿌리로부터 발생한 줄기는 평균 1.9개이었는데 지면에서 갈라진 줄기를 각각의 개체로 간주하였을 때(줄기 기준) 살아있는 개체는 총 1,398개체이었으며 고사한 것은 114개체로 총 1,512개체가 조사되었다. 지면으로부터 20 cm높이에서의 평균둘레는 $5.9{\pm}3.2$ cm, 평균높이는 $159{\pm}51$ cm이었다. 개체의 둘레 크기를 10계급으로 구분한 결과 두번째로 작은 계급의 개체수 가장 많았으며 크기가 증가할수록 개체수가 감소하였다. 그러나 높이 크기를 10계급으로 구분한 결과는 정규분포에 가까운 형태를 나타냈다. 고사한 개체는 둘레 크기에는 작은 계급에 속하였으나 높이의 크기에서는 상위 2계급만 제외하고 전 계급에 분포하였다. 동일한 지하부를 갖고 있는 개체를 하나로 간주하였을 경우(뿌리 기준) 20 cm 높이에 서의 면적을 10계급으로 구분한 결과 가장 작은 크기의 개체가 대부분을 차지하였고(83.8%), 크기가 증가할수록 개체수가 현저히 감소하였다. 위성류 매목은 군락의 중심에 집중분포를 하였으며 상대적으로 남북 방향이 동서방향보다 더욱 심한 집중분포의 경향을 보였다. 가장 큰 매목의 수령은 8년이었다. 위성류 뿌리의 생장형태는 크게 두 가지인데 하나는 지표면 근처에서 수평 방향으로, 다른 하나는 수직 방향으로 생장하고 있었다.

  • The aim of this study was to observe processes and implication to a given program for the 20 gifted children grade 5 by making the number from 1 to 100 with natural numbers 4,4,9 and 9. Revelation of creativity, mathematical tendency of students and meaningful responses were observed by the qualitative records of this game activity and the analysis of result. The major result of a study is as follows: The mathematical creativities of students were revealed and developed by this activity. And the mathematical attitude were changed and developed, so student could actively participate. And students could experience collaborative and social composition learning by presentations and discussion, competition with a permissive atmosphere and open-game rule. It was meaningful that mathematical ideas (negative number, square root, factorial, [x]: the largest integer not greater than x, absolute value, percent, exponent, logarithm etc.) were suggested and motivated by students themselves.

  • The general number field sieve (GNFS) is asymptotically the fastest known factoring algorithm. One of the most important steps of GNFS is to select a good polynomial pair. A standard way of polynomial selection (being used in factoring RSA challenge numbers) is to select a nonlinear polynomial for algebraic sieving and a linear polynomial for rational sieving. There is another method called a nonlinear method which selects two polynomials of the same degree greater than one. In this paper, we generalize Montgomery's method [12] using geometric progression (GP) (mod N) to construct a pair of nonlinear polynomials. We also introduce GP of length d + k with $1{\leq}k{\leq}d-1$ and show that we can construct polynomials of degree d having common root (mod N), where the number of such polynomials and the size of the coefficients can be precisely determined.

  • An effective rapid propagation method was established through in vitro cultures of the medicinal plant, Cudrania tricuspidata. In vitro plantlets were obtained from in vitro germinated seeds. The various levels of cytokinins (BAP, Kinetin and TDZ) were tested on multiple shoot formation from plantlets. BAP (1.0 mg/l) treatment induced highest number of multiple shoots. Single shoot cultures gave higher initial shoot numbers than 5 shoots per culture. Among the various culture media, the shoot elongation was optimal on 2 MS basal medium without growth regulators. The IAA (2.0 mg/l) treatment induced highest number of roots. IBA (2.0 mg/l) treatment more promoted in vitro root growth than other concentrations. Rooted shoots were transferred directly to small pots with an artificial soil and successfully acclimatized.

  • A numerical study for a two dimensional multi-impingement jet with crossflow of the spent fluid has been carried out. To study the flow characteristics especially in the jet flow region, three different distributions of mass flow rate at 5-jet exits were assumed. For each distribution, various Reynolds numbers ranging from laminar to turbulent flows were considered. Calculations drew the following items as conclusion. 1) A periodical fully developed flow was observed from the third protrusion. This was also observed from previous experimentally by Whidden at al. The Nessult number at the protrusion surface increased mildly as going downstream. 2) The low Reynolds number turbulence model of Launder and Sharma was found to be adequate for the prediction of fluid flow and heat transfer characteristics of two dimensional multi-jet configuration. 3) The Nusselt number at the protrusion surface was nearly proportional to the square root of the Reynolds number.

  • Fuzzy logic based control has recently been proposed for regulating the properties of magnetorheological (MR) dampers in an effort to reduce vibrations of structures subjected to seismic excitations. So far, most studies showing the effectiveness of these algorithms have focused on the use of a single MR damper. Because multiple dampers would be needed in practical applications, this study aims to evaluate the effects of multiple individually tuned fuzzy-controlled MR dampers in reducing responses of a multi-degree-of-freedom structure subjected to seismic motions. Two different fuzzy-control algorithms are considered, a traditional controller where all parameters are kept constant, and a gain-scheduling control strategy. Different damper placement configurations are also considered, as are different numbers of MR dampers. To determine the robustness of the fuzzy controllers developed to changes in ground excitation, the structure selected is subjected to different earthquake records. Responses analyzed include peak and root mean square displacements, accelerations, and interstory drifts. Results obtained with the fuzzy-based control schemes are compared to passive control strategies.
